Pre-operative Evaluations
When preparing for LASIK surgery, the preliminary step entails undertaking pre-operative evaluations to guarantee your eyes appropriate for the procedure. These evaluations are vital as they assist your ophthalmologist figure out if LASIK is a safe and reliable alternative for fixing your vision.
Throughout the analyses, your optometrist will analyze different aspects such as the shape and thickness of your cornea, your eye health, and the stability of your vision prescription.
Additionally, pre-operative evaluations generally consist of dimensions of your pupils, corneal curvature, and the refractive mistakes in your eyes. These in-depth measurements provide crucial info that guides the customization of your LASIK procedure.
Your optometrist will also examine your medical history and review any kind of potential dangers or complications that might develop from the surgery.
LASIK Surgery Procedure
As you step into the operating room for your LASIK surgical procedure, you will start a transformative trip in the direction of clearer vision. The treatment commonly takes about 15 mins per eye. You'll lie down on a comfortable bed, and numbing decreases will be put on your eyes to ensure you remain pain-free throughout the surgical treatment.
Next off, a tiny tool will certainly hold your eyelids available to stop blinking. The specialist will use a specialized laser to produce a thin flap on the surface of your cornea. This flap is raised to reveal the underlying corneal cells, where one more laser will certainly reshape the cornea to remedy your vision.
During this time around, you may experience some stress and listen to clicking noises from the laser. However, the procedure is quick and pain-free.
As soon as the cornea is improved, the flap is repositioned, and the recovery procedure begins immediately. This surgical treatment offers a high success price in improving vision and lowering or getting rid of the need for glasses or get in touches with.
Post-operative Care
Following your LASIK surgical treatment, appropriate post-operative treatment is critical to ensure a smooth and successful recovery procedure. Your eye doctor will certainly provide certain guidelines customized to your individual needs, but right here are some basic standards to remember.
Firstly, make sure to relax your eyes instantly after the procedure. Avoid rubbing or touching your eyes, and use the protective eye guard offered to you, particularly while sleeping. Your physician may prescribe eye decreases to aid with recovery and avoid infection, so be diligent in using them as routed.
It's important to attend all follow-up appointments as set up to monitor your development and address any kind of concerns immediately. Avoid swimming or hot tubs for at least a week, and refrain from difficult tasks that might put strain on your eyes. Furthermore, limit display time, particularly in the initial couple of days post-surgery.
